Description
A flaw was found in gstreamer1-plugins-good. The isomp4 plugin's qtdemux_parse_tree function incorrectly handles MP4 file parsing, resulting in a heap buffer over-read. This flaw allows a local attacker to trigger this vulnerability by providing a specially crafted MP4 file. This over-read can lead to information disclosure.
